A well designed three bedroom semi detached house built approximately seven years ago by Crest Nicholson Homes. This particularly well cared for property certainly warrants an early viewing.

Downstairs there is an attractive fitted kitchen/diner with attractive bay window to the front and a living room with double doors leading out onto the rear garden. There is also a useful cloakroom.

Upstairs the master bedroom boasts two sets of fitted wardrobes and an ensuite shower room. There are also two further well proportioned bedrooms and a modern bathroom.

There is a car port to one side of the house for two cars and an enclosed 25ft rear garden. Within the garden there is both a patio and decking area plus useful garden shed.

Harrietsham is a popular village boasting an excellent primary school, two shops, railway station and gastro pub. The larger village of Lenham is only a short drive away and the county town of Maidstone and the M20 motorway are also easily accessed.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
